Oase von Ruhe! Weinbergspark is a public park located in the Mitte district of Berlin, Germany. The park is named after the vineyard that once stood on the site in the 19th century.The vineyard was established in the mid-19th century by the French wine merchant Jean Jacques Bouché, who saw an opportunity to produce wine in the fertile soil of the area. The vineyard was successful for a time, but it eventually fell into disuse and was abandoned.In the early 20th century, the site was transformed into a public park. The park was designed in the English landscape style, with winding paths, open lawns, and numerous trees and shrubs. During World War II, the park suffered significant damage and was largely destroyed.After the war, the park was restored and became a popular gathering place for local residents. In the 1960s, the park was renovated again and new facilities were added, including a playground and sports fields.During the 1980s, Weinbergspark became an important center of Berlin's alternative culture scene. The park was a popular gathering place for artists, musicians, and activists, and it was the site of numerous political demonstrations and cultural events.After the fall of the Berlin Wall in 1989, the park underwent another round of renovations and was expanded to include a new amphitheater and community garden. Today, Weinbergspark remains a popular destination for locals and tourists alike. The park features a large playground, sports fields, and numerous paths for walking and jogging. It also hosts a variety of cultural events throughout the year, including music festivals and art exhibitions.
